Paul and Timothy.. and 1 Corinthians 14:33b-36 (Main Forum)

by herbie @, Tuesday, April 03, 2012, 16:38 (412 days ago) @ MaryN

What's more, Mary, the passage against women at 1 Cor 14:33b-36 is not by Paul. It is an interpolation (a later insert) in the interests of those who wrote 1 Timothy.

This is not special pleading. In your NRSV the words are in brackets to indicate (1) they are out of place in the context; (2) their place in the text is not secure; (3) they contradict what Paul says in 1 Cor 11 about women prophesying (=teaching); (4) they contradict what elsewhere says about his women 'co-workers' (Romans 16; Philippians 4:2-3). etc...

Michael Morwood: "The Challenge in Resurrecting Jesus in Society Today"Michael Morwood: "The Challenge in Resurrecting Jesus in Society Today" In this address given to WATAC (Women and the Australian Church) members on 26th March 2013, Michael Morwood outlines the challenges he sees the Church facing in the years ahead. This address was given in the theatrette of the NSW Parliament at a meeting to celebrate the 50th Anniversary of the Second Vatican Council. 33m 34s [Commentary on the Catholica where this address was published on 29Mar2013] | [WATCH THE VIDEO]
